2014-09-28 114 views
-1

我想要做这样的事情的指标:获取标签

if (tabControl1.TabPages[0].Text == "Tab nr 1") { } 

是这样的可能吗?

+1

是什么问题? – 2014-09-28 10:41:53

回答

1

您可以使用以下方法:

var index = tabControl1.SelectedIndex; 
var tab = tabControl1.TabPages[index]; 

或者干脆

var tab = tabControl1.SelectedTab; 
+0

但我不想选择一个。例如,我想要标签页1的文本。 – spunit 2014-09-28 10:40:56

+0

...然后请解释你真正想要什么。我不清楚。因为'tabControl1.TabPages [0] .Text'会给你选项卡#1的文本,所以到目前为止没有问题... – ChrFin 2014-09-28 10:45:06

+0

哦,对不起,我只是猜测的代码,但它其实是对的!当我尝试它时,它并没有出现,但那是因为我意外地比较了错误的字符串,真是愚蠢......好吧,无论如何,感谢您的帮助,我会设置您的解决方案作为答案,谢谢=)。 – spunit 2014-09-28 10:52:04